Abstract

This technology ensures that important information stored in the drone's memory device is reliably erased if the drone performs an unexpected action (such as an emergency landing or crash). [Solution] A sheet of explosive (130) is attached to the memory body (121) that constitutes the memory device (120). When there is a risk that the drone will be captured by the enemy, the sheet of explosive (130) is ignited via an ignition device (150), burning the memory body (121) and causing the important information stored in the memory body (121) to be lost.
